Hi,

I have had this problem with this program back when it was position size calculator and now after upgrading to the EA program - Position Sizer for MT5 - the same issue.

I have been using this for a long while, love it and understand it pretty thoroughly...BUT for some reason, it won't let me execute a trade (I use pending/limit orders) shortly after the NY close. It takes about an hour or so to allow me to place a trade. I hit the "hotkey" and nothing happens...until later on. Then when I try an hour or two later, it works. Is there something I am missing?

Thank you!
When you press the hotkey or click the Trade button on the Trading tab, check the Experts tab - it will output what it does there. Perhaps, there is an execution delay, but perhaps, there is some other problem, which it will write about there.

Hi. Great work as always... I hv been a huge fan and user of Position Size Calculator since few years ago with the one using PSC Script to quickly put in a trade. This new Position Sizer is amazing. Kudos to the Team in its further development.

I have a suggestion... One which I believe if can be implemented will be a game changer for Position Sizer EA. I have been trading lately using the Pound Averaging Strategy used by big boys taught by my mentor. What this does is to open multiple PO POS (position) at various prices but all with the same SL. So, e.g. if I decided to execute a netting strategy with 5 Sell Limit POS because price is playing out based on my strategy parameters. The very 1st POS I set either an instant or Sell Stop to trigger the 1st order for me to be in play. As I believe there would be a retrace before moving forward to my intended analysis, I will then set Sell Limit orders. So, the next 5 Sell Limit POs I would like to input POS 1 at 1.0000, POS 2 at 1.0010, POS 3 at 1.0020, POS 4 at 1.0030 and POS 5 at 1.0040 with all these 5 Pending Orders are with the same SL value. However, with the TP I would like to have options to have all TP value of each POS the same price value (OR)..., manually/by pulling the line on the chart to set each POS differently. Meaning e.g. POS 1 the TP set at 0.9980, POS 2 the TP set at 0.9980, POS 3 the TP set at 0.9960, POS 4 the TP set at 0.9940 and POS 5 the TP set at 0.9940

Pound averaging strategy ensures that I have a better price when price goes against initially but still keeping the same SL value of each POS. So, on the last POS essentially I'm risking a smaller SL amt but when price goes in favour, my 5th, 4th and 3rd POS will start amassing more pips and better returns than the 2nd and 1st POS. If for whatever reasons price stalls and doesn't go beyond my 1st POS I can close all the POS' with still a sizeable +ve TP amount. This is in itself controlling my risk management with a smarter approach. But if price does go in my favour puncturing through POS 1 then I'm in good profit for all 6 POS' and just wait till price hits the already set individual TP values for each of the 5 POS'.

So..., that's what I see can be a wonderful feature if the Pound Averaging feature can be coded into Position Sizer EA. I'm not sure if it could be done (as I'm a noob in coding, and thus I leave it to you to see if it can be done?) but if it can..., this definitely is a game changer in my eyes as I've learnt this from my mentor and it's a wonderful strategy that has shown superb results. We're all trading using this strategy to maximise profits when it works out and if it doesn't by going against, we're still able to manage our funds at the end, coming out with +ve returns.

I hope you see the value in such a feature and if this could be done and added into Position Sizer EA in the next update I am sure it will be a biggie for everyone to enjoy :) Anyway, you're the expert and let me know how this goes... Can it be done and is it useful... Cheers
